QUINN-MARSHALL CO. v. McDANIELS CO.

No. 778.

5 F.Supp. 937 (1934)

QUINN-MARSHALL CO. v. McDANIELS CO., Inc.

District Court, M. D. North Carolina, Winston Salem Division.

February 12, 1934.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

E. C. Bivens, of Mount Airy, N. C., for creditors.

Benet Polikoff, of Winston Salem, N. C., for trustee.

L. C. McKaughan, of Winston Salem, N. C., referee.


HAYES, District Judge.

It appears from the evidence that the Quinn-Marshall Company and E. W. McDaniels organized a corporation and called it the McDaniels Company, Incorporated, and subscribed for $18,000 of capital stock; Quinn-Marshall taking $12,000 and E. W. McDaniels taking $6,000.
